udev has this nice feature of creating "dead" /dev/<node> device-nodes if
it finds a devnode:<node> modalias. Once the node is accessed, the kernel
automatically loads the module that provides the node. However, this
requires udev to know the major:minor code to use for the node. This
feature was introduced by:

  commit 578454ff7eab61d13a26b568f99a89a2c9edc881
  Author: Kay Sievers <[email protected]>
  Date:   Thu May 20 18:07:20 2010 +0200

      driver core: add devname module aliases to allow module on-demand 
auto-loading

However, uhid uses dynamic minor numbers so this doesn't actually work. We
need to load uhid to know which minor it's going to use.

Hence, allocate a static minor (just like uinput does) and we're good
to go.

---
 drivers/hid/uhid.c         |    3 ++-
 include/linux/miscdevice.h |    1 +
 2 files changed, 3 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-)

--- a/drivers/hid/uhid.c
+++ b/drivers/hid/uhid.c
@@ -640,7 +640,7 @@ static const struct file_operations uhid
 
 static struct miscdevice uhid_misc = {
        .fops           = &uhid_fops,
-       .minor          = MISC_DYNAMIC_MINOR,
+       .minor          = UHID_MINOR,
        .name           = UHID_NAME,
 };
 
@@ -659,4 +659,5 @@ module_exit(uhid_exit);
 MODULE_LICENSE("GPL");
 MODULE_AUTHOR("David Herrmann <[email protected]>");
 MODULE_DESCRIPTION("User-space I/O driver support for HID subsystem");
+MODULE_ALIAS_MISCDEV(UHID_MINOR);
 MODULE_ALIAS("devname:" UHID_NAME);
--- a/include/linux/miscdevice.h
+++ b/include/linux/miscdevice.h
@@ -45,6 +45,7 @@
 #define MAPPER_CTRL_MINOR      236
 #define LOOP_CTRL_MINOR                237
 #define VHOST_NET_MINOR                238
+#define UHID_MINOR             239
 #define MISC_DYNAMIC_MINOR     255
 
 struct device;
